Every two hours, someone in the UK will become paralysed. Globally, it is estimated that 15.4 million people are living with paralysis. At Spinal Research our vision is to create a world where paralysis can be cured, no matter when the injury occurred or where in the world.

On 4 August 2011 we ride from the Tower of London to the Eiffel Tower: 200 miles in 24 hours.

A bunch of freinds and I, who all are known to do a bit of riding now and again thought that it would be a great idea to see if we can push ourselves a little bit and try to get ourselves from one great city to another on bikes (and a ferry) over the course of a day and night, whilst having a load of fun and raising some money for charity.
